Procrastinate

Description:

Procrastinate is a verb that refers to the act of delaying or postponing tasks or actions that require attention, usually by indulging in less important or more enjoyable activities instead.

Senses and Usages:

Sense 1: Deliberately delay or defer tasks

Example Sentence 1: Don't procrastinate your homework until the last minute; it will only add unnecessary stress.

Example Sentence 2: Despite knowing the importance of the project, he continued to procrastinate and struggled to meet the deadline.

Sense 2: Engage in pleasurable distractions

Example Sentence 1: I often find myself procrastinating by scrolling through social media instead of doing productive work.

Example Sentence 2: Even though the presentation was due, she decided to procrastinate by watching her favorite TV show.
